An Original Vintage Theatrical 8" x 10" [20 x 25 cm] Movie Still (Learn More) Joe Louis was a legendary black African American boxer from the 1930s to the 1950s. He was the world heavyweight boxing champion from 1937 to 1950, winning 26 championship fights during that time. He enlisted in the army at the start of 1942, and served all the way until 1945! He passed away in 1981 at the age of 66. Important Added Info: Note that Joe Louis first fought Jersey Joe Walcott (who was the same age as Louis) in 1947, and Walcott knocked him down twice, and most people think Walcott clearly won the fight, but it was awarded to Louis. This still is from their rematch in Yankee Stadium the following year, and Walcott knocked him down in the third round, but Louis knocked out Walcott in the eleventh to retain his title again at age 34.
